Carl Steward profiles 16-year-old Robbie Wirth, a U.S. Fly Fishing Team member and co-captain of the World Youth Fly Fishing Team that will travel to Slovakia in August.
“Wirth says he fishes as much as 35-40 weekends a year and during the week whenever he can. He spends a couple of hours at night tying flies, and last year, he built his own drift boat in order to better fish the bigger rivers such as the Upper Sacramento. He’s serious about his sport.” In the Mercury News.
